Perth-Andover

See also: Andover

Perth-Andover is a village of the county of Victoria, located at the west of the New Brunswick.

Demography

According to the census of Statistical Canada, it there had 1908 inhabitants in 2001, compared to 1861 in 1996, that is to say a rise of 2,5%. The village counts 843 private residences, has a surface of 9,27 km ² and a Population density of 205,8 inhabitants to the km ².

Administration

The Maire is Karen Titus and the city council men are James Baird, Carter Kennedy, Rickey Beaulieu, David Morgan and Susan Murchison. Perth-Andover was the Chef-lieu county of Victoria of her creation in 1837 until the abolition of the governments of county, in the Années 1960.
